Transaction 75b20622add5875b343df589f236190fb1f2c5e7fc0722fbcacc1aa22c79b594
1 Input
1 Output
-
75b20622add5875b343df589f236190fb1f2c5e7fc0722fbcacc1aa22c79b594:0
- value
- 245024
- script pubkey
- OP_0 OP_PUSHBYTES_20 70f0643861c564361e2ae7d7981e3f79199b404e
- address
- bc1qwrcxgwrpc4jrv832ultes83l0yvekszw3tdrw2